Product Description This Sylvania 5" Portable Black and White TV with AM/FM Radio is perfect for taking on the road or moving from room to room. Portable set features a 5” black and white TV, AM/FM radio, 3-way power source, AC adapter, car adapter, earphone jack, built-in antenna and colored interchangeable face plates.
